The vibrant music scene of Northeastern Pennsylvania is already gearing up for the 11th annual Steamtown Music Awards, a highlight of the renowned Electric City Music Conference.

Set to take place on Thursday, Sept. 12, 2024 in Scranton, this prestigious event not only marks the launch of the ECMC but also celebrates the talent and contributions of musicians and music professionals in the 570 area code, recognizing and honoring their achievements over the past year.

Nominations for the SMAs officially open on Thursday, Feb. 1, inviting enthusiasts and industry experts alike to recognize excellence in over 35 categories. From “Song of the Year” to “Music Video of the Year,” the awards cover a diverse spectrum of genres, honoring the rich musical tapestry of the region.

One of the unique aspects of the SMAs is the inclusion of online voting, accounting for 50 percent of the final vote in each category. The remaining 50 percent will be determined by the SMAs committee, ensuring a fair and comprehensive evaluation. The People’s Choice Award, an exciting addition to each category, will spotlight standout performers who garnered significant fan support through social media and live concerts.

Nominees, performers, and presenters will enjoy free complimentary access to the Steamtown Music Awards, creating an inclusive atmosphere that celebrates the entire music community. For guests, tickets are available for $10.

The red carpet will once again be rolled out, offering nominees and visitors the chance to make a grand entrance. Live streamed interviews, official red carpet photos, and the promise of surprises will add glamour to the event. The award ceremony itself will feature captivating live performances, showcasing the talent that defines the dynamic local music scene.

As part of the Electric City Music Conference, the awards contribute to a three-day music festival featuring over 150 bands from across the country performing at various venues across the city on Friday, Sept. 13 and Saturday, Sept. 14. Attendees will also have the opportunity to participate in panel discussions and mentoring sessions, creating a platform for musicians, professionals, and music fans to connect and learn.
